The text of Article 1 of the United Nations Aarhus Convention Treaty, which the Republic of Ireland Government has ratified, reads as follows:
"In order to contribute to the protection of the right of every person of present and future generations to live in an environment adequate to his or her health and well-being, each Party shall guarantee the rights of access to information, public participation in decision-making, and access to justice in environmental matters in accordance with the provisions of this Convention."
In connection with "Irish Water", has the overall membership of three main branches of the Republic of Ireland Government (Executive, Legislative, and Judicial) complied with all of the main points in Article 1?
If not, then it seems to me that the Republic of Ireland Government -- which is a "Party" in the "Irish Water" Project for the reasons set out in Article 2 of the Aarhus Treaty -- has a case to answer; and, that it can be taken before the international law courts if it has violated Article 1 in any major way.
The full text (in over two dozen languages) of the United Nations Aarhus Convention Treaty is available via the following UN web page:
